All Star Sessions
All Star Sessions is an album by saxophonist Gene Ammons recorded between 1950 and 1955 and released on the Prestige label.
Reception
The Allmusic review by Stewart Mason stated: "A bop classic, All-Star Session was the recording debut of Gene Ammons as a leader with his group the Gene Ammons All-Stars, featuring his fellow tenor saxophonist Sonny Stitt... Those looking to explore Stitt and Ammons' enormous catalogs could do much worse than starting right here".Track listing

- Recorded in New York City on March 5, 1950, October 28, 1950, January 31, 1951 and at Van Gelder Studio in Hackensack New Jersey on June 15, 1955
Personnel
- Gene Ammons – tenor saxophone, baritone saxophone
- Sonny Stitt – tenor saxophone, baritone saxophone
- Art Farmer, Billy Massey – trumpet
- Chippy Outcalt – trombone
- Lou Donaldson – alto saxophone
- Charlie Bateman, Duke Jordan, Junior Mance, Freddie Redd – piano
- Addison Farmer, Tommy Potter, Gene Wright – bass
- Art Blakey, Kenny Clarke, Jo Jones, Wes Landers – drums
- Larry Townsend – vocals
